Evana formed in Barcelona in the early 1990s with vocalist Eva Perales, guitarist Joan Ballester, bassist Jordi Puig, and drummer Albert Moreno. Their debut album 'Pasión Latina' came out in 1993.
In 1998, their second album 'Romántica' included a remix of 'Vamos a La Playa' that became widely popular. The song had originally appeared on their first album.
Some critics have questioned whether the band's approach to Latin music borrows too heavily from traditional sources without acknowledgment. The group has described their work as paying tribute to the music they grew up with.
